Give a gift to a loved one who is no longer with you. Recite something wonderful in their memory at the Christmas dinner,
share your memories of them—perhaps a talent or even a fault, nobody’s perfect. The greatest gift for someone
who is no longer with us is to be remembered!
Talk to the children about their grandparents (whether living or deceased). If deceased take out their picture and put
it where it can be seen, have a toast at the dinner table in their honour. They are the ones who for so many years contributed
so much to the family.
Think of the lonely this Christmas. It might be your neighbour, or it might be someone in your family, or it might be a
total stranger. Give the gift of your time, words of encouragement! Put your heart in high gear at Christmastime.
Look for gifts that do not involve money. Do errands for someone, who may have difficulty doing them on their own. Extend
a hand to someone who needs affection. Pray for world peace.
Give your kids extra hugs at Christmas. Give thanks for all your blessings. Say a Grace before your family meal.
Remember the gifts that are very special are the ones you give just because you want to say I love you. Christmastime
is a really special time to show kindness to your loved ones. Gifts are special gestures from your heart.
